Notable Awards and Recognition, Malala yousafzai net worth

Malala’s tireless advocacy for girls’ education has earned her recognition across the globe. She has received numerous awards and accolades, including the Nobel Peace Prize in 2014, the first person from Pakistan to receive this honor. Other notable awards include the Gleitsman International Activist Award, the Olof Palme Prize, and the International Children’s Peace Prize.

  1. The Nobel Peace Prize (2014)This prestigious award was presented to Malala in recognition of her struggle against the suppression of children and young people and for the right of all children to education. The prize committee acknowledged her bravery and her tireless advocacy for girls’ education as a fundamental human right.
  2. The Gleitsman International Activist Award (2013)Malala received this award in recognition of her outstanding contribution to human rights. The award is given annually to an individual who has made a significant impact in the field of human rights.
  3. The Olof Palme Prize (2015)

    Malala shared this award with Kailash Satyarthi, an Indian children’s rights activist, for their joint efforts to protect children’s rights, especially their right to education.

  4. The International Children’s Peace Prize (2013)

    Malala was awarded this prize by the KidsRights Foundation for her advocacy for girls’ education and her efforts to protect children’s rights.
